Finding Your Perfect Fit: The Wide Shoe Buying Guide for Women
Finding shoes that truly fit can be a challenge, especially if you need extra width. Wide shoes offer comfort and support for many women. This guide helps you choose the best pair.
Key Features to Look For
When shopping for wide shoes, certain features make a big difference in comfort and fit. Look closely at these elements:
- True Wide Sizing: Check the sizing chart. Most brands use ‘D’ for wide and ‘E’ or ‘EE’ for extra wide. Make sure the label matches your actual need.
- Toe Box Shape: A wide toe box lets your toes spread naturally. Avoid shoes that taper too sharply at the front. Square or rounded toe boxes usually offer more room.
- Adjustability: Look for laces, Velcro straps, or adjustable buckles. These allow you to customize the fit across the top of your foot.
- Arch Support: Good support prevents foot pain. Even in wide shoes, strong arch support is essential for all-day wear.
Important Materials
The materials used affect how the shoe feels and lasts. Choose materials that breathe and stretch slightly.
- Leather and Suede: These natural materials often mold to your foot over time. They offer good durability.
- Mesh and Knit Fabrics: These are excellent for breathability, keeping your feet cool. Modern knit materials stretch easily, accommodating wider feet comfortably.
- Outsole Rubber: A sturdy rubber outsole provides good grip and cushioning. Thin, hard plastic soles often offer poor shock absorption.
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
Not all wide shoes are created equal. Quality matters for long-term comfort and health.
Quality Boosters:
- Removable Insoles: High-quality shoes often include removable insoles. This lets you replace them with custom orthotics if needed.
- Stitching and Construction: Look for strong, even stitching. Poorly glued seams often separate quickly.
Quality Reducers:
- Stiff Materials: If the shoe feels rigid right out of the box, it might not stretch enough. Stiff materials can cause rubbing and blisters.
- Shallow Heel Cup: A deep, supportive heel cup keeps your foot stable. A shallow cup lets your heel slide around, causing friction.
User Experience and Use Cases
Think about where and how you will wear the shoes. The best shoe for running differs from the best shoe for the office.
- Everyday Walking: For daily errands, prioritize cushioning and flexibility. A lightweight sneaker or a comfortable walking loafer works well.
- Work/Professional Settings: Many dress shoes are narrow. Look for wide pumps or loafers with hidden elastic panels for stretch. Comfort should not sacrifice professionalism.
- Standing All Day: If you stand for long periods, seek out shoes with excellent shock absorption in the midsole. A slightly wider heel base also improves stability.
Always try on shoes later in the day. Your feet swell slightly as the day goes on, giving you the most accurate fit check.
10 Frequently Asked Questions About Wide Shoes for Women
Q: How do I know if I actually need wide shoes?
A: If your feet bulge over the sides of your current shoes, or if you feel pinching or numbness, you likely need a wider fit.
Q: What is the standard width measurement for women?
A: Standard width for women is usually labeled ‘B’. Wide is ‘D’, and extra wide is often ‘E’ or ‘EE’.
Q: Can I stretch regular shoes to fit wider?
A: You can stretch them slightly, but forcing a narrow shoe wider risks damaging the structure and causing pain.
Q: Are wide shoes always bulky looking?
A: No. Many modern brands design stylish wide shoes that look similar to standard widths, focusing on internal space rather than external bulk.
Q: Should I size up in length when buying wide shoes?
A: Do not size up in length to gain width. This causes you to trip or causes your heel to slip out. Buy your correct length and the correct width.
Q: Are wide running shoes different from wide casual shoes?
A: Yes. Wide running shoes usually have specialized cushioning and support features built specifically for impact absorption during exercise.
Q: How much space should there be between my longest toe and the end of the shoe?
A: You should have about a thumb’s width of space, roughly half an inch, between your longest toe and the front of the shoe.
Q: Do wide shoes help prevent bunions?
A: Yes, properly fitting wide shoes reduce the pressure that often aggravates bunions or causes them to form.
Q: Can I wear socks with wide shoes?
A: Always try on wide shoes while wearing the type of socks you plan to wear with them—thicker socks take up internal space.
Q: Is it better to buy shoes that are slightly big or slightly small?
A: It is much better to buy shoes that are slightly too big than too small. Shoes that are too small cause immediate pain and long-term foot problems.
